E-32, Sector-xi,, Noida - 201301, Uttar Pradesh, India
No. C-400, Sector 10,, Noida - 201301, Uttar Pradesh, India
A-54, Sector-83, Noida - 201305, Uttar Pradesh, India
Plot No D - 196, Sector - 10,, Noida - 201301, Uttar Pradesh, India
Unit I, A-38, Sector-57,, Noida - 201301, Uttar Pradesh, India